"Drive Format Failed" on a new USB 3.2 drive. Solution: CineAsset Pro 5211 requires drives to be removable . Some external SSDs (like Samsung T7) identify as fixed disks. Use a SATA-to-USB adapter for bare SSDs or a CRU carrier. cineasset pro 5211 windows
